今天碰到了一台联想ThinkStation P2的台式机,14代CPU+主板,为了能更好的兼容CentOS7.9,将CPU更换为12代的i7-12700,硬盘配置1T固态+4T企业级,显卡为:NVIDIA RTX 3060,机器本身是带有集成显卡和集成网卡的,但是很遗憾,7.9最新的版本都不支持(在安装的时候就无法识别,包括声卡),这个不是重点,重点是在安装7.9的时候,只需要点击centos install 回车后,机器直接黑屏,无论是独显还是集显,都是黑屏状态,根本没法安装,但是很明显(通过键盘灯,能够知道,机器并没有死机,移动硬盘的数据等还在闪烁),说明安装过程是在进行的,只是不显示;
解决方法:
1. 在使用U盘或者光盘进到安装界面时,不要选第一项centos install ,选择第3项 Troubleshooting;
2. 进去后,依然选择第1项 Install CentOS 7 in basic graphics mode ,选中后别直接回车,这里是重点,此时长按住Shift键(别问我按了有什么用,我也不知道,但是不按,回车就黑屏),同时按回车;此时你能看到显示屏是亮的,且能正常进入到7.9 的安装流程了,剩下的基本就是正常的安装步骤,这里不在讲述;
3. 当系统安装完成后,你会发现,依然进不了系统,仍然是黑屏状态,这个时候我们需要进BIOS,将不兼容的集成显卡,声卡,网卡都禁用掉;自己多加一块普通的网卡(最好是在装系统前就把BIOS相关的禁用,然后加一块独立的网卡,这样就能在安装系统时候联通网络,指定网卡IP地址),知道网卡IP后,系统安装的时候选择Server GUI 版,把右边的选项都勾上,这里主要是用到SSH;
4. 机器重启后虽然黑屏,但是我们可以通过ssh 远程连接到机器,到这里就是我们正常的安装nvidia显卡的流程了,不会的去我主页看安装方法,显卡驱动打完后,直接重启,然后能正常进入系统了;
时间有点着急,随便记录一下,这过程当中有可能会出现
ABRT has detected 1 problem(s). For more info run: abrt-cli list --since 1717387510
这种错误,不过没关系,直接使用root模式,然后输入
abrt-auto-reporting enabled
就能解决!
记录如此~~